Can I integrate a smart gate with a pool fence?
Yes, but the IoT system must not compromise the primary safety code. Under 780 CMR, a pool barrier requires a self-closing, self-latching gate with a 48-inch minimum height. An integrated smart latch must meet these mechanical standards first. This dual-compliance is now standard for managing modern liability in Massachusetts.
Which fencing materials perform best in local soil?
Select materials for corrosion and pest resistance. Northampton has moderate soil corrosivity and a moderate termite risk level. Use pressure-treated wood rated for ground contact or vinyl composites. For metal posts and fasteners, specify hot-dip galvanized steel to prevent rust streaks that violate historic district aesthetic guidelines.
How do you build a fence to withstand high winds?
Design for the 115 MPH V-ult wind speed rating. This ultimate design wind speed, per ASCE 7-22 standards, dictates post spacing, concrete footing size, and bracket strength. For open or exposed sections, we reduce panel spans and use through-bolt connections to resist peak storm season gusts common from the I-91 corridor.
What are the legal steps for a boundary fence in Massachusetts?
Notify your adjoining neighbor. Massachusetts General Laws Chapter 49, Section 3, known as the 'good neighbor law,' requires written notice before replacing a shared partition fence. In Northampton, this 2026 standard is a prerequisite for any work on a property line, even with a 0-foot setback. Obtain and document their consent.

How do Northampton zoning rules affect fence design?
Height and location are strictly regulated. The code limits fences to 4 feet in front yards and 6 feet in rear yards. For corner lots, especially those near I-91, you must maintain a clear 'sight triangle' for traffic visibility. Any fence within a city-regulated historic district also requires a separate design review certificate from the Northampton Historical Commission.
What is required before digging fence post holes?
Call Massachusetts Dig Safe at 811. This free utility locate service is mandatory. Hitting a buried line in a dense neighborhood like Downtown Northampton results in major repair costs, service disruptions, and liability. What is the most critical engineering factor for a fence in Northampton?
Frost heave. The 48-inch frost line depth requires all structural posts to be set with concrete footings below this level. In Downtown Northampton, posts set above this line will lift during winter freeze-thaw cycles, causing permanent failure. This is a non-negotiable requirement under IRC Section R403 for footing stability.
